How These Brushes Clean Between Your Teeth
You insert the brush gently between your teeth, allowing the bristles to sweep away plaque and bacteria from the interdental spaces. The 0.7mm wire core provides the right balance of flexibility and strength, enabling you to navigate the contours of your teeth without causing discomfort.
The cylindrical brush head moves in and out of the gap, creating a cleaning action that disrupts bacterial biofilm formation. You can angle the brush slightly to ensure thorough cleaning of both tooth surfaces within each interdental space, promoting healthier gums and fresher breath.
Who Should Use Size 4 Yellow Brushes
You may find these interdental brushes suitable if you have medium-sized gaps between your teeth, typically measuring around 0.7mm. The size 4 designation indicates they work well for people with moderate interdental spacing who need more than floss but less than larger brush sizes.
These brushes are particularly beneficial if you experience:
- Difficulty reaching back teeth with regular floss
- Gum bleeding when using traditional flossing methods
- Food trapping between specific teeth
- Recommendations from your dentist or hygienist for interdental cleaning
You should consult your dental professional to determine the correct size for your individual interdental spaces, as using the wrong size may be ineffective or cause gum irritation. Storage and Replacement Guidelines
You should replace these brushes when the bristles become worn, bent, or lose their effectiveness, typically after several uses depending on your cleaning frequency. Store them in a clean, dry place between uses to maintain hygiene and prevent bacterial growth on the brush heads.
You can rinse the brushes with water before and after each use, and some people prefer to use them with interdental gel or fluoride toothpaste for enhanced cleaning benefits. Regular replacement ensures optimal cleaning performance and reduces the risk of introducing bacteria into your interdental spaces.
